Scope of Work:

The work shall include, but is not limited to, providing all tools, materials, labor, equipment, and incidentals necessary for the successful site grading and construction of an ADA concrete paved parking stall, concrete pedestrian walk ways, flatwork, and sidewalks, installation of water and sewer services, surface/subsurface drainage appurtenances, preparation of pad foundation for installation of a new prefabricated restroom building to be installed by the restroom manufacturer, installation of a play equipment area and surfacing, concrete seat walls, and related ADA improvements and associated improvements for the successful construction of the Project. All utilities not replaced will be protected in place including manholes and returned to their prior condition. The work will also include any required traffic control, signage, public notifications, stormwater control, shoring, formwork, and all other work necessary to render the infrastructure/facility complete and operational, as shown on the Project Plans and Specifications, as specified herein, and in accordance with City of Morro Bay Standard Specifications and Drawings, and Caltrans Standard Specifications.

If a bid is submitted by a Contractor who is not licensed with classification “A” license in accordance with the
provisions of the California Contractors License Law, the Bidder’s Bond shall be forfeited as detailed in Section 8.2
of the Invitation to Bidders. The City reserves the right to reject any and all bids, to waive irregularities, and make an
award deemed in the best interest of the City. Postmarks and facsimiles are not acceptable.
Bids shall be executed on the forms provided in the book of bidding documents and in accordance with the instructions
contained therein. Bids submitted in any way other than on those project-specific, City forms will not be accepted.
Bid security, in an amount not less than 10 percent (10%) of the total bid dollar amount, is required to be submitted
with each bid. The bid security shall be in the form of a bidder's bond or a certified or cashier's check drawn upon a
responsible bank made payable to the City of Morro Bay and conditioned to be forfeited to the City in the event the
bidder, if their bid is accepted, does not enter into a written contract within ten (10) days after the Notice To Proceed
is issued after the awarding of the contract. The bidder to whom the award is made will be required to furnish a
payment bond and a faithful performance bond.

Prevailing wages shall be paid in accordance with the provisions of Sections 1770 and 1780 of the State of California
Labor Code of the State of California and the Compliance Monitoring Unit within the Division of Labor Standards
Enforcement. In addition, the following conditions apply:
No contractor or subcontractor may be listed on a bid proposal for a public works project (submitted on or
after March 1, 2015) unless registered with the Department of Industrial Relations pursuant to Labor Code
section 1725.5 [with limited exceptions from this requirement for bid purposes only under Labor Code
section 1771.1(a)].
No contractor or subcontractor may be awarded a contract for public work on a public works project (awarded
on or after April 1, 2015) unless registered with the Department of Industrial Relations pursuant to Labor
Code section 1725.5.
This project is subject to compliance monitoring and enforcement by the Department of Industrial Relations

The Engineering Division has calculated an estimate of probable construction costs for this project. The City does not
wish to publicize the engineer's estimate of the project cost since this information may tend to influence the number
and nature of bids received. However, for the bidder's convenience and bonding estimating, the engineer's estimate
falls within a range of $400,000 to $500,000. The allotted time of construction for this project is FIFTY-FIVE (55)
WORKING DAYS. A WORKING DAY is every weekday, except legal holidays as defined in Section 1-2 of the
Special Provisions.
